Working on new (blocking) event machine.
The new event machine will be used for loose coupling and handle the communications between the services: 1) Block pool finds blocks which "links" with our current canonical chain 2) Posts the blocks on to the event machine 3) State manager receives blocks & processes them 4) Broadcasts new post block event
